Physical Description:
Caitrin appears to be almost entirely rabbit except for the ferret-like 'mask' on her face, and her long, black-tipped tail, both of which she inherited from her mother. Without those two features, she would easily blend in with her fellow rabbits, with her long, slender ears and a coat of fur that's a 'dirty white' all over, though whether that's actually dirt or just its natural color is a bit up in the air. Her eyes shine a bright bright blue and the glasses which usually are settled just in front of them on her muzzle combined with the slightly unkempt 'mane' of blue-black hair that falls around her face, just to her shoulders gives her something of a 'scientist' look, mad or otherwise remains to be seen.

Her clothing varies depending on what she's out doing. If she's simply going to meet someone, she usually just wears the various bits of normal clothing she's managed to gather up (t-shits and a few pairs of sturdy jeans being most common). When she's actually going to a job, however, she wraps up in her overcoat, under which she can hide the bag of various first aid supplies and some medical tools she has obtained through 'less than legal' means. Unless she's going to be around people she knows and trusts, she hides her tail under her coat to avoid extra trouble. No matter what she has planned, though, she never goes anywhere without her glasses if she can help it, needing all of her senses to be at their best in the dangerous places she treads.

Background:
Caitrin was born as the pride and joy of her parents, who had both always wanted a little girl and hoped to give her an even better life than they had known, thanks to her mixed heritage. Unfortunately, Caitrin was born too close to being a pure rabbit to be labeled a true hybrid, which meant that none of the family qualified for UniClass status, and while that may not have caused any real detriment to them in the early years, it wasn't long before growing tensions in the city started to really affect their lives. Her parents supported the idea that everyone should come together in mutual support and care for eachother, but did not believe that one had to be a hybrid to do so, and this belief quickly rubbed off on Caitrin. This belief only grew stronger as the Ministry's actions grew closer and closer to real terror tactics while most of the Outer Class simply seemed to be trying to live their lives.

By 23 ECE, Caitrin's parents had taken a sudden interest in teaching Caitrin things they felt she would need to know in what they believed to be a dark time coming. First aid and reading were heavily focused on, so she would be able to read and understand labels and books as well as be able to patch herself, or others, up if the need came up. It was daunting work for one so young, but she dedicated herself to it to please her parents, trusting their judgement. Hardly a month after Caitrin's seventeenth birthday, the skills she had worked hard to develop were put to use after the horrifying Colony attack on Einheit, and while the girl was hard at work patching up the wounded and caring for the dying with many other similarly skilled people, her parents both joined the thousands of others killed in the attack. It took several days for someone to inform her they had died due to the sheer number.

Despite being trained to be able to survive on her own, Caitrin wasn't at all mentally prepared to have it come so soon, or so suddenly. She stayed with some friends of the family for a few months, trying to pull herself back together as the city spiraled the drain, and she helped keep them healthy while they showed her some of the ins and outs of scavenging to make money, reasoning that bandaging someone from time to time wouldn't keep the stomach full, and because they needed her help with their own scavenging if she was going to be staying with them. After leaving their care, she got herself a bolthole in Midcity, near her old home, and built her own life.

Personality:
Caitrin is a kind sort, offering to give her aid to her friends any time they need her, and willing to help out strangers (though she's more cautious about that, since she doesn't want to end up getting mugged or worse). She partly blames herself for her parent's death, because she wasn't 'hybrid enough' to assure them a place in the safety of the Toride, but she lays most of the blame on the Ministry for their strict standards, and for that reason, she refuses to take part in their Hybridization process. She'll either be taken as-is, or not at all. Despite these feelings, however, Caitrin believes that she must help those who need her, even if it were a diehard Minister who was injured. She wouldn't like it... in fact, it might make her feel sick while she was giving him or her care, but she believes that not refusing to aid makes her a better person than someone who judges a person based purely on how hybrid they are.
